Join the Argyll and Sutherland Highlanders Museum for a Very Cruachan Christmas!
Corporal Cruachan IV, the SCOTS Regimental Shetland Pony, will be visiting Stirling Castle with Pony Major Corporal Mark Wilkinson from 10.30am.
Come and say hello and ask Mark all your questions about Cruachan.
Afterwards, pop in to the museum to have a look at some of the Argylls’ Christmas collection, and make your own Christmas cards to take home with you, or get involved with some of our other activities. Crafts will take place from 10.30am.
